LegCo Panel on Food Safety and Environmental Hygiene begins its duty visit to Japan
************************************************************

The following is issued on behalf of the Legislative Council Secretariat:

     The Legislative Council (LegCo) Panel on Food Safety and Environmental Hygiene departed for Tokyo, Japan today (September 25) to begin its six-day duty visit in response to an invitation from the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Japan.

     The purpose of the visit is to enable members to better understand the up-to-date situation in Japan following its earthquake in March this year. During the visit, the delegation will study, among others, the food safety measures taken by the relevant authorities in Japan in response to the Daiichi nuclear power plant incident, the surveillance and testing of food in particular on the radiation levels for export from Japan, as well as the impact of the Daiichi nuclear power plant incident on food exporters in Japan.

     During its stay in Japan, the delegation will visit Tokyo, Kumamoto and Miyazaki. The delegation will meet with the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Japan; the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are; the Ministry of Agriculture, Forestry and Fisheries; the Food Safety Commission; and the Kumamoto Prefectural Government officials. The delegation will also visit the National Diet of Japan; the Wholesale Market Sanitation Inspection Station at Tsukiji; the Inspection Station for Agricultural Product Exports in Kumamoto; and the Safety Inspection Station for Beef in Miyazaki.

     The delegation comprises three members: Hon Tommy Cheung Yu-yan, Chairman of the Panel on Food Safety and Environmental Hygiene; Hon Fred Li Wah-ming and Hon Wong Yuk-man, members of the Panel.
